Actually Tom, that's not how it works, my MoC is actually named for its ability to fire the Bludgeon missile and then retrieve it using a spool of thread. All I did was drill a tiny hole at the end of the missile, feed the thread in and tie a knot. The other end I fed through the firing mechanism and then wrapped around the spool. When the button on top is pressed, the missile fires about 6 feet and then you simply wind it back in again. I thought this was a cool idea because my grandson is always loosing the missiles.
   I also thought it fit well when it comes to a post apocelyptic theme, where resources are hard to find.

When the Bludgeon Retreiver is salvaging the waste land and comes across a hostile force, the missile can be fired to knock the baddies off their wheels, even roll a vehicle in some cases. This method makes sence in the wasteland, because what you conquer you get to keep. And we didn't just blow up our prize, we simply dented it.
